Tim Tebow Video: Watch Polarizing Broncos QB Rock Out to 'All I Do Is Win'

Mike ChiariNov 29, 2011

Say what you will about Denver Broncos quarterback Tim Tebow, but since taking over the starting job from Kyle Orton, the Broncos are 5-1. You might even say that all Tebow does is win, making DJ Khaled's "All I Do Is Win" a perfect track for the unorthodox signal caller.

In a poorly-doctored yet hilarious video, Tebow's head was superimposed onto that of a rapper in the "All I Do Is Win" music video. Perhaps no player in the entire NFL is as polarizing as Tebow, but he is beginning to silence the critics thanks to his winning ways.

Tebow will likely have to significantly improve as a passer in order to maintain success over the long haul, but his interesting style has been enough to get the Broncos into second place in the AFC West at 6-5, just one game behind the Oakland Raiders.

Despite trailing late in the fourth quarter, Tebow led the Broncos to an overtime victory over the San Diego Chargers on Sunday, effectively ending the Bolts' playoff hopes in the process. It took a late drive and a missed field goal by Nick Novak in the extra session, but Tebow put his team in position to win.

Much of Denver's recent success has to be given to a swarming defense that has been much improved under new head coach John Fox. The fact remains that Tebow has run the option with plenty of effectiveness as he has an acute sense of when to hand the ball off to Willis McGahee or keep it himself.

As long as the defense continues to play like it has, then Tebow and the Broncos will likely keep winning. Even the slightest dip in production from the defense will alter the offense, however. The Broncos aren't a team that can come from behind with Tebow under center.

The song says, "All I do is win no matter what," but if Tebow is forced to play like a conventional quarterback, then his winning ways will likely come to a screeching halt. Tebow may get all the credit for being a winner, but the fact is that the Broncos are winning with team football.
